Here is a checklist for an initial evaluation of an eLearning company:
- Identify vendors: Conduct an Internet search or solicit information from other users who have similar business goals.
- Develop evaluation criteria: The evaluation criteria to evaluate an eLearning company should focus on overall requirements, such as:
- ‘Fit for purpose: Does the eLearning company have an LMS that delivers a feature set that aligns with your business objectives?
- Architecture: Does the eLearning company meet your requirements in terms of hardware, scalability, security, modularity, and robustness?
- Interoperability: Does the eLearning company provide an LMS with ease of system integration and standards compliance?
- Usability: Is the LMS user-friendly?
- Cost of ownership: What are the costs of development and support?
- Maintenance: How difficult or simple is the maintenance?
